LTE-M System Design and Performance Test of FAO Urban Rails

 
 

Abstract


Fully Automatic Operation (FAO) technology and application have developed rapidly in urban rails now; it puts forward higher requirements to train-ground wireless communication than other CBTC (Communication Based Train Control) systems. The wireless communication throughput demands of different services are proposed at first in this paper. Then Long-Term Evolution for Metro (LTE-M) redundancy network architecture are designed to meet the demands. LTE-M system testing platform is established to verify the performance in simulating real environment of FAO urban rails. At last LTE-M integrated services system performance are measured. Testing results shows that LTE-M networks we designed can meet the reliability and performance demands of train operation related services, and provide considerable quantity data rates to production and maintain services.
